There are many Facebook posts sharing that during lockdown people have been eating more “treat foods” such as chocolate, cake, homemade banana loaf etc… Or the meme’s that state that “we’ll be so fat at the end of Lockdown; we won’t be able to get out of the front door”.

Boredom and eating go hand in hand a lot of the time HOWEVER, do you really want to come out of lockdown unhealthier, having put weight on, which may make you feel more sluggish, unhappier in yourself and unable to fit into your clothes? Most of these “treat” foods are full of sugar; which weakens the immune system and wreaks havoc with our emotions and hormones!

In our Pre-Lockdown life, we knew that exercise was crucial to a healthy mental state, decreasing stress levels and boosting our immune systems.  BUT now, more than ever, these key benefits of exercise are absolutely VITAL!

The global energy of “Lockdown” is holding many in a state of fear, stress and anxiety, which is utterly draining on all of our energy systems. You may be experiencing less energy than normal, an inability to focus clearly or a lack of motivation. Giving yourself permission to “feel all the feels” is much needed and slow down when your body or mind is calling for you too. The danger happens when we spiral out of control; because then getting back on that first rung of the ladder to “getting up and moving” becomes truly difficult.

We can’t fight what is happening in the external world with Lockdown, but we can EMBRACE this time that we have been gifted and put it to good use. You can choose to focus some of this time towards improving your fitness levels and overall health, knowing that exercise in whichever form you choose, is a positive step to a healthier mind & body!

There have been numerous exercise opportunities – trainers are offering free online training sessions in exercise or yoga.  YouTube is full of home workouts, download an app such as the couch to 5k or just get yourself out of your house every day for a walk. Find a way of exercising that suits YOU! You may even be surprised at what exercise you do love and discover an unknown passion.
